feat(d21): P1+P2 — module-defined field schema (backend)

module.field_spec (FieldDef[]: key/label/type/options/required) declares a
module's own operational fields, validated on create/update. client_module
gains field_values (JSON map of non-secret values, type-checked against the
owning module's spec) + secrets_enc (one AES-GCM blob over a {key:plaintext}
map; the clear key-list prefix lets the UI show which secrets are set without
decrypting). Routes: PUT /client-modules/:id/fields (staff), POST
/client-modules/:id/secrets + /reveal-secret (managerial, audited, plaintext
never logged). Additive over D20 — provider/username/password stay. Both
engines (SCHEMA + migrate guards + pg 003). 11 new tests; module suite green.
